Glass-Replacement-150x150.jpgFriction hinges are available in a wide variety of sizes and materials to meet specific requirements for particular applications. When selecting a friction pivot for their product, engineers must consider factors such as load, environmental conditions and aesthetic preferences.

Engineers must consider the normal force when deciding on the friction-based hinge. This is the force perpendicular to the surfaces of contact. This is important because it determines the amount of pulling force is required to open the item that the hinges are mounted.

Restricted friction hinges

Friction hinges make use of friction to create resistance to the pivoting motion of doors, lids and other objects. They differ from conventional hinges that rely on mechanical bearings and rely on lubricants to enable them to pivot without restriction. Friction hinges come in various sizes and configurations and are a great solution for any application that requires the ability to restrict movement or change positions of an object.

Cold-rolled steel is the most commonly used metal used in friction hinges. Its low melting point and sturdy physical properties make it a good choice for a variety of applications for friction hinges. Aluminum is another popular choice due to its strength and resistance to corrosion. Aluminum is also relatively light, which makes it easy to set up and remove friction hinges. Its high tensile strength allows it to withstand the weight of large windows and doors without deforming under stress.

Certain friction hinges are constructed with a spring built-in which limits the force required to open and close the hinged door repairs or device. These are called detent friction hinges, and they are perfect for applications which require a certain opening angle. Detent friction hinges are found in kitchen cabinets as well as laptop computers, storage cabinets and machine covers.

Other friction hinges are designed for a smooth and slow closing. These are known as soft-close hinges, and they make use of hydraulics to reduce the force needed to close the lid or door. These hinges help prevent damage from a sudden, jarring closing.

There are many different torque ratings for friction hinges. Some hinges are designed to generate more torque than others, however all hinges can withstand some amount of force. The force needed to open a hinge is determined by the number of hinges as well as their location and also the dimension of the object attached to them.

Restricted window friction stays (also called restrictor friction stays) are a possibility for most uPVC windows, as well as timber and aluminum. They can be installed to limit the opening of windows to a safe location. They also have a slider that makes it easy to clean.

Steel friction hinges

Steel friction hinges are used in heavy-duty uses such as industrial doors and furniture. They are able to withstand high torque and come in various lengths. They are easy to install and to maintain. They can also be adapted to meet specific application requirements with a variety of options for adjusting hinge position. These include barrels and knuckles.

Window-Repairs.-150x150.jpgStainless steel friction hinges are popular due to their strength and resistance to corrosion. They are used in various applications, including laptop computers and cabinet doors. They can be mounted on the surface or concealed. Typically, they are constructed of steel. However, certain models also come in aluminum or plastic. The choice of material depends on the environment in which the hinge will function. Factors like the type of environment, temperature, as well as humidity can affect the material specification.

If the hinge is exposed to salty environments, then stainless steel could be the ideal choice since it resists corrosion and rust. Bronze and brass are resistant to salt corrosion and they can be used in decorative applications. They aren't as sturdy as stainless steel.

Some friction hinges are controlled by a constant torque angle that allows them to move in any direction. They are generally more expensive, however they are ideal for hygienic and corrosion-prone applications. These hinges are available in zinc, aluminum, or, for a more durable option, stainless steel.

It is essential to take into account the weight and the dimensions of the door or enclosure when deciding which hinge is the best one for you. You will also have to determine the required torque. Hinges are usually designed to handle up to 100 kilograms but you can find custom sizes to meet your specific requirements.

When selecting a hinge, it is essential to consider the design of your project. Some hinges can be seen and others are hidden to create a seamless look. Hinges can be painted to match the colour of your furniture or polished to a dull finish to create a more subtle look.

Restrictor friction hinges

These restricted friction hinges restrict how far the window can open, and are perfect for rooms where safety of children is an issue. When you press a button, the restriction can be removed. The window friction hinges will then open fully as it would normally. We have top-hung and side hung restricted hinges Check out the technical diagram in the image gallery to determine the kind of hinge you need.

These uPVC restricted window hinges are available in both 13mm non handed and 17mm handed heights to suit most windows including uPVC, aluminium and timber. These uPVC hinges for restrictors are available in matching pairs and can be easily fitted to existing uPVC windows to enhance child safety and security without the necessity of additional locking systems.

Restriction friction hinges can be adjusted to provide the ideal amount of resistance for any motion of opening or closing. Their spring-loaded mechanism reduces noise and protects hinges from the damage caused by a forceful closing. Restriction friction hinges combine safety, noise reduction, and hinge protection to offer the ultimate in controlled movement. Installation requires technical expertise for the most efficient results.

Adjustable friction hinges

Torque hinges are also known as friction or hinges with a position control. They make use of friction to resist motion and hold a panel lid or door in the correct position. This is to ensure security and for convenience. They are available in a variety of torque strengths, mounting positions, and specifications. Engineers can customize some of them to meet their unique needs. Engineers must consider the function that the hinge is expected to perform as well as the dimensions and weight of the parts it will hold when selecting hinges.

The materials used to make adjustable friction hinges include stainless, cold-rolled steel, bronze, and aluminum. The choice of material is based on the conditions and the purpose. Bronze is, for example, extremely resistant to corrosion and has great ductility, making it a great choice for marine applications. Brass is also a popular choice because of its machinability as well as its strength. It is also lightweight, and resists the effects of saltwater corrosion better than many other metals.

An effective way to determine which type of hinge is best for a specific project is to calculate the amount of torque it generates and the maximum torque it can handle. Then, engineers can select the most appropriate hinge to meet the needs of their customers and users. Engineers should also think about the durability and long-term performance of the hinge to prevent damaging equipment.

Friction hinges are available in a variety of models and feature a single way force. They can be left or right hand opening and feature a balanced or centralized torque. They can also be constructed out of various materials including steel, which is the most commonly used.

In addition to the force of a hinge, engineers should take into consideration the amount of free play. This is the maximum distance that a flap or upv door hinges will move before the hinge opens and activates the free-stop mechanism. This feature is helpful for LCD displays, medical devices and other devices that require frequent opening. It can prevent accidental slamming of the product and reduce the chance of damage to the equipment or injuries to the user.
